Zidan started but Failed to impress:

Egyptian striker Mohamed Zidan started together with Guerrero in attack. However, the Egyptian lacked confidence and didn't perform well. To be fair, all HSV squad looked awful as they failed to penetrate the organized defense from Duisburg side and also failed to deal with the pressure that the guests applied on HSV forwards.

Zidan is indeed a great player and he proved how good he is in the last season as he scored 13 goals in 15 games for Mainz. However, he couldn't shine with Hamburg this season for a variety of reasons. The most important of which is his lack of first team football.

But more importantly, Zidan is not getting support from his teammates who often try to find Van der Vaart or Guerrero with their passes but they rarely look for Zidan. The Egyptian also plays out of position most of time and he is not getting enough support from the coach. Due to this, Zidan tries not to overuse his skills and to get rid of the ball.

Zidan should be given more creative freedom and support from the coach, but unfortunately this is not the case in Hamburg and so, it won't be surprising if the Egyptian moved to another club this summer.


In today's game, Zidan barely got the ball, he did well in some occasions as he provided some good passes especially for Guerrero. He also got a golden chance to score early on but the Egyptian couldn't convert.

The match was pretty tight as Duisburg put all HSV key players under immense pressure and closed the gaps in their defense well. As a result, Hamburg had a lot of troubles in the game as the forwards looked isolated at front and when they got the ball, they lose it quickly due to pressure.

Duisburg won the game by a single goal which came through Grlic who volleyed the ball home from 25 yards.
